902 ½ Lincoln Way
Auburn, California
Type: Card Room
Status: Closed
Open: 1961, Close: 1980s

Private social club.

T. R. King sold 2000 of these small crown chips in two denominations to Roy Carlisle, 128 East Post Street, Auburn, California, for use at the Tahoe Club, 902 1/2 Lincoln Way, Auburn, California, in 1965.
